BTC price falls below $39,000
The world's oldest cryptocurrency has been struggling with a downward trend recently. Bitcoin price fell below $39,000 in today's session, a huge 20% loss given the ETF's weekly high of $48,969. At press time, BTC was valued at $38,919.42 on Tuesday, down 4.39%.
The cryptocurrency had a market capitalization of $762.87 billion, indicating a decline of 4.51%. In contrast, Bitcoin trading volume increased by 82.63% to $31.10 billion. The significant decline saw BTC fall from a high of $41,169.30 to a low of $38,839.95 on Tuesday.
Ali Martinez, a popular crypto analyst, suggested that Bitcoin price could even fall below $33,000, citing historical trends. He explained: “Looking at the last two bull cycles, $BTC has typically fallen back to the 50% Fibonacci level after reaching the 78.6% Fibonacci level.”
The analyst added that Bitcoin recently reached the 78.6% Fibonacci level again. Therefore, he expects a correction to the 50% Fibonacci level if the historical pattern continues. Furthermore, he explained that this could cause the BTC value to fall as low as $32,700, indicating a 16% decline from the current price.
